Phase 2 Study of ADX-038 in Participants With Geographic Atrophy

A Phase 2, Randomized, Masked, Placebo-Controlled Study of Subcutaneously Administered ADX-038 in Participants With Geographic Atrophy (GA) Secondary to Age-Related Macular Degeneration (AMD)

Conditions

Geographic Atrophy Secondary to Age-related Macular Degeneration

Brief summary

Phase 2 study is designed to assess the efficacy of ADX-038 compared with placebo in participants with GA secondary to AMD. Safety, pharmacokinetics (PK), and pharmacodynamics (PD) will also be assessed.

Inclusion criteria

* Clinical diagnosis of GA of the macula secondary to AMD * GA lesions between 2.5 and 12.5 mm2 at screening * Sufficiently clear ocular media, adequate pupillary dilation and fixation to permit quality fundus imaging in the study eye as described in the protocol * Willing and able to comply with clinic visits and study-related procedures, including completion of the full series of meningococcal vaccinations and pneumococcal vaccination required per protocol

Exclusion criteria

* Has GA secondary to causes other than AMD * Has active ocular disease that compromises or confounds visual function * History of surgery for retinal detachment * Has ocular condition other than GA secondary to AMD * Use of intravitreal complement inhibitors in study eye * Hereditary or acquired complement deficiency * Active viral, bacterial or fungal infection * Liver injury as evidenced by abnormal liver function tests * Donating blood * History of choroidal neovascularization in the study eye

Design outcomes

Primary

MeasureTime frameDescription
Evaluate the effect of ADX-038 on the preservation of the EZ layer12 monthsRate of change in the area of total EZ loss in the study eye from baseline to Month 12
